from tHe director:

This musical Back to the Eighties was not our first choice. In fact, it was ‘down the list’ of our preferences for 2024. However, in hindsight, it truly was the one we should always have been looking towards. With the advent of every ‘musical year’, the challenge comes to find something different to continue to push and grow our students, as this is the primary question around the mammoth investment that we make, whether it’s financial, time, talent or the sheer hard grind of rehearsals. Back to the Eighties is like nothing we’ve done in my time at King’s Reedy Creek, at least.

Flash back 40 years - I myself was in Year Eight, a spotty 12-yearold, singing along to the AM radio station in a rural Queensland town, watching the film clips on television and reading the magazines to stay up with the pop culture. The phones were still attached to the wall, and we had to ride our bikes to visit each other after school, and maintaining our ‘tribal affiliations’ through our friendships was of the utmost importance in the social pecking order.

Flash forward to 2024 and our students aren’t much different – apart from the facts that they don’t listen to ‘the radio’ or ‘read magazines’, nor do they ‘watch film clips on TV’ much either. But they do love pop culture, no matter how they find it. Celebrities, music, Hollywood stars – they’re all still part of our lives, just as much as finding our ‘tribe’ in which we belong. This musical has brought untold opportunities for us ‘oldies’ to share with the ‘youngsters’ what it was like – the similarities (there were lots!) and differences (there weren’t many) of being a teenager in a school where the jocks and the nerds think they’re poles apart, and the ‘normal kids’ get stuck in the middle. Everyone reckons that ‘no-one understands what I’m going through’ and yet, peel off the outer layer, we’re all simply craving acceptance and acknowledgement, as we navigate our way towards our unique identities.

It has been a delight to journey back into last century’s most colourful and upbeat decade, and our students got to experience a slice of their parents’ upbringing which may possibly produce some empathy for the fashion choices they see in old photos, and the dance moves that appear when a Madonna or Bon Jovi song comes on!

The Company has learned much about themselves and their fellow performers, and grown in appreciation for hard work, dedication and commitment to ‘nailing that choree’ one more time. I would like to sincerely thank not only the students and their families for the support and understanding during our fast and furious rehearsal process, but more importantly our Creative Team who have not only pushed our students to become better artists on stage, but better people offstage. To Simon, Ellia, Sara, Glenn, Nat, Lance, Ben, Jacob & Caitlin – thank you for coming on board this crazy ride, and I pray that you too have many precious memories from this experience. Dare I suggest that we’ve had the ‘Time of (our) Lives’!
